Oliver Anderson (born 30 April 1998) is an ex- Australian tennis star. Anderson was found guilty and exiled from professional tennis because he was accused of fixing during his first round match in the 2016 Latrobe City Traralgon ATP Challenger.

After finding the player in violation of two provisions of the TACP The TACP was found to be in breach by Professor McLaren determined that the 19-month suspension he had been serving, since being suspended for a provisional period in February 2017 was a complete and final sanction for disciplinary. The player was not exempted for a further period or fine was inflicted which means that Anderson could resume professional tennis. But due to his persistent injuries, Anderson was forced to quit and is now an athlete coach for the tennis association, Lifetime tennis.

On 5 January 2017, Anderson was charged with match-fixing his first round match at the 2016 Latrobe City Traralgon ATP Challenger in October 2016. Anderson was approached to tank the first set of his first round match against Australian Harrison Lombe. He lost the first set 4–6, but won the next two 6–0, 6–2.

In September 21 2018, Anderson was convicted of tennis match-fixing charges. The Independent Hearing Officer ruled that 19 months provisional suspension already served by the player was full and final sanction for breaches of the Tennis Anti-Corruption Program. The disciplinary case against Anderson was adjudicated by the independent Anti-Corruption Hearing Officer Prof Richard H. McLaren, following an investigation by the Tennis Integrity Unit.

Anderson is most famous for his win at his first title in 2016 at the Australian Open – Boys’ Singles title over Jurabek Karimov.

Anderson began his career at 14 in March of 2013 when he won the opportunity to play a wildcard in one of the Australian the futures event in the in the state of Queensland. He lost in the opening round of both doubles and singles events. Anderson achieved the first rank point of his career in of 2013 when he beat Jay Andrijic in the first round of an Australian futures event held in Cairns. Anderson continued to increase his standing throughout 2014 and 2015 , with a number of victories throughout the challengers circuit and Futures tournaments.

At the start of the year of Anderson was granted a wildcard qualifying to his home tournament, The Brisbane International. He recorded two unexpected wins after a set loss against 8th place Dennis Novikov and the fourth seed Tim Smyczek in order to get his first ATP main draw event, at 17. He played Croatian Ivan Dodig in the first round, and lost 7-6 6-1, with a score of 6-2. Anderson was then granted wildcard to tournaments in 2016 including the Australian Open men’s qualifying tournament as well as Junior boys’ tournament. Anderson lost during the 2nd round of the qualifying event, but went on to take the junior singles championship with an impressive three-set win against the Uzbekstan’s Jurabek Karimov at the end of his final. Anderson won his first title as a junior grand slam champion. Anderson was not able to play until the month of May, when the tournament ended in the first round of qualifying for the Busan the Seoul Challengers. Anderson took a further four months off to undergo hip surgery and returned back to playing on playing on the ITF circuit during September. On October 1, Anderson got a wildcard in the Traralgon Challenger. He fell in the second round to John-Patrick Smith. Anderson finished this year with an ATP rating of 736.

In May 2017, Anderson pleaded guilty to the match-fixing charge and was fined $500 by Latrobe Valley Magistrates Court, Victoria.
